University of Northwestern Ohio vs. Norwich University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, University of Northwestern Ohio or Norwich University?

  • Norwich University is 281% more expensive to attend than University of Northwestern Ohio for in-state tuition ($42,860.00 vs. $11,250.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 281% higher at Norwich University than University of Northwestern Ohio ($42,860.00 vs. $11,250.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of Northwestern Ohio than Norwich University ($16,860 vs. $24,501)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Northwestern Ohio are 125.7% lower than costs at Norwich University ($7,000 vs. $15,800)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Norwich University than University of Northwestern Ohio (100% vs. 63%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Norwich University students is 484.8% larger than aid received University of Northwestern Ohio ($38,481 vs. $6,580)

University of Northwestern Ohio vs. Norwich University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, University of Northwestern Ohio or Norwich University?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Norwich University and University of Northwestern Ohio.

  • The graduation rate at Norwich University is higher than University of Northwestern Ohio (55% vs. 46%)
  • Graduates from Norwich University earn on average $12,700 more per year than University of Northwestern Ohio graduates after ten years. ($52,900 vs. $40,200)
  • University of Northwestern Ohio students graduate with a $5,602 lower median federal student loan debt than Norwich University graduates. ($21,398 vs. $27,000)
  • University of Northwestern Ohio graduates are paying $58 less per month on federal student loans than Norwich University graduates. ($221 vs. $279)
  • More Norwich University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former University of Northwestern Ohio students, three years after graduation. (80% vs. 52%)
